This role provides intermediate-level application engineering, system analysis, design, development, implementation, and production support for Vanguard's retirement and participant experience platforms. The engineer contributes to modernization initiatives, cloud-native application development, UI and backend services, API integrations, observability, secure software delivery, and Site Reliability Engineering (SRE) practices. This position plays a key role in modernizing retirement termination experiences and requires an engineer who can balance software development, production support, cloud operations, and reliability practices to deliver secure, scalable, resilient, and maintainable solutions.

Vanguard is one of the world's largest investment companies, offering a large selection of high-quality low-cost mutual funds, ETFs, advice, and related services. Individual and institutional investors, financial professionals, and plan sponsors can benefit from the size, stability, and experience Vanguard offers. As of April 30, 2019, we managed more than $5.6 trillion in global assets. In addition, we have 189 funds in the United States and 225 funds in global markets.
